David, contacted my company with the generous opportunity to place an ad for our business in his " publication" Hotel Employees Referral.... a publication that he claims is distributed to hotel employees providing referrals for local services.

 

David, explained that this ad would be exclusive, and that after coming across one of our advertisements he had hand selected  us to have the only real estate services ad in his publication.

 

When meeting with Mr. Brin, he was unable to provide referrals, unable to provide a list of vendors with whom his publication is distributed, and despite the title Hotel Employees Referral was not able to list one hotel his publication was distributed

 

David also claimed that these magazines, where distributed to all medical offices, including UMC, SunriseHospital and Valley. However, after further investigation it was found that not one of the hospitals or medical offices David noted had ever heard of him.

 

Davids explanation for this was that the HR managers were/are to blame because the remove his material.

 

Adding to this highly suspect advertising company is the fact that David only accepts checks. David came to our office, and called our office 6 times less than 24 hours after meeting with him to pick up his check.  He made several attempts to speak directly with our accounting department claiming they should have a check ready for him. Moreover, who to make it out to.  

 

I should note, that David associated himself with Martin Sullivan Design claiming his email address is ( and I quote) martinsullivandesignatgmailDotnet. 

 

It does not take a genius to know, that there is no gmail.net much less a DOTnet.

 

Davids business licenses has been revoked/expired since July 2009 yet he still operates his business, scamming people after seeking their ads out in established publications. Offering  exclusive advertisements  months at a time to all casino employees, or to all medical offices, medical employees, construction employees etc.
